Spelling & Dictionary Insight

The German entry for Nationalelf is 11 letters long, classified as a noun, and transcribed in the International Phonetic Alphabet as [nat͡si̯oˈnaːlˌʔɛlf]. Corpus data places it at rank #33,728 in overall German word frequency, marking it as uncommon enough that many writers pause before typing it. The dominant gloss from Wiktionary reads: "Mannschaft, die in internationalen Wettbewerben gegen die Auswahlmannschaften anderer Nationen antritt".
